Pharmacist Supervisor
This is an on-site role in Lake Mary, Florida.
Job Overview:
The Pharmacist Supervisor is responsible for overseeing the day to day activities of the pharmacist and other pharmacy teams. The Pharmacist Supervisor services as the front line resource for pharmacist questions and escalations. The Pharmacist Supervisor is actively involved in monitoring the training and development process of the pharmacist and pharmacy teams and assists in the development of policies and procedures specific to the Fortrea Specialty Pharmacy daily operations.
Pharmacist Supervisor communicates with prescribers as needed to confirm dosing and administration to ensure the correct and safe dispensing for patients; controls medications by monitoring drug therapies; responsible for identifying and reporting adverse events and product complaints in accordance with pharmacy regulations and client requirements; counsel patients on medication, how and when to take medication as well as potential adverse events and strategies to minimize events; conduct additional outreach, follow up and counseling to patients as required by regulatory agencies such as a REMS; stay abreast of pharmacy laws and changes; complete continuing education courses to maintain and renew license(s); ensures compliance with all applicable program guidelines; performs related duties as required.

Pharmacist Responsibilities:
Prepare medications by reviewing and interpreting provider orders; detecting therapeutic incompatibilities
Responsible for various duties related to the fulfillment of prescription orders
Process, pack and ship outgoing pharmacy orders, ensuring drug, related supplies and patient educational materials are included
Prepare and scan documents, verify provider and patient data, submit prescription orders in computer system
Contact providers for clarification on prescriptions
Maintain safe and clean working environment by complying with procedures, rules and regulations.
Counsel patients on prescriptions being dispense including side effects, initial counseling requirements, storage requirements and delivery method if needed
Able to document verbal prescriptions within pharmacy system
Responsible for interacting with technicians and other staff members in a professional manner
Verify prescription orders within pharmacy computer system and be able to determine prescription meets state and/or federal requirements
Able to communicate with providers/patients and staff members
Maintain pharmacological knowledge by reviewing professional publications, and maintaining Continuous Educational requirements
Responsible for staying up to date on all pharmaceutical product, pharmacy and program training
Able to meet department metrics within first 90 days of start day and maintain going forward
Competent to work in pharmacy computer system efficiently
Competent to open and/or close the pharmacy and building during shift if required
Capable of proper documentation of Controlled Substance dispenses
Capable of troubleshooting or solving clinical pharmacy inquires
Able to arrive early to shift to ensure pharmacy is open and ready for operations
Able to stay after shift to ensure pharmacy is closed properly or shipments have been secured
